On Friday, September 23, 2011, the gold spot price was C$1,683.35 per troy ounce in Canadian Dollars, equivalent to ¥175,573.41 JPY per ounce or ¥5,644.81 JPY per gram. Gold fell -3.76% from the previous trading session.

Currency fluctuations between CAD and JPY significantly impact the effective cost of gold for international investors. Japan is the world's third-largest economy and a significant gold consumer, particularly for jewelry and industrial applications. The Bank of Japan's ultra-loose monetary policy has historically supported higher gold prices in Yen terms, making Japan an active gold market for both institutional and retail investors.
